The 8th session of the GRE Task Force on Glare Prevention (9 June 2026, Brussels) approved the previous meeting’s report and received feedback on GRE-94. The Task Force discussed headlamp cleaning requirements, the 2000 lm light output limit, horizontal aiming for passing-beam orientation, and periodic technical inspection compatibility with Regulation No. 48. The GTB Task Force will submit an update at the 9th session targeting ranking of proposed glare-prevention solutions. The Task Force will next address glare from light signalling devices and then work on countermeasures. The 9th meeting is scheduled for Tokyo on 8 September 2026, and the 10th meeting for Brussels in December 2026.
